Squid or Nginx? - V2EX
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
如果你希望学习 CDN 相关知识,那么建议你可以遍历以下软件的说明文档。
NGINX
cURL
Livid
173.88D
580.6D
V2EX    CDN

Squid or Nginx?

  •  
  •   Livid
    PRO
    2012-05-14 09:28:20 +08:00 5834 次点击
    这是一个创建于 4930 天前的主题,其中的信息可能已经有所发展或是发生改变。
    目前国内几乎所有的 CDN 的服务节点都在用 Squid,用 Nginx 的很少,貌似安全保用的是 Nginx?

    Squid 究竟有什么特性是 Nginx 无法取代的么?
    8 条回复    1970-01-01 08:00:00 +08:00
    rhwood
        1
    rhwood  
       2012-05-14 09:49:02 +08:00   4
    @livid Squid没有什么是无可取代的,squid只不过是缓存前端界的asp .net,过时了。现在这个时代属于Varnish Haproxy Nginx 可以免费为V2ex提供CDN咨询
    likuku
        2
    likuku  
       2012-05-14 09:51:01 +08:00   1
    Varnish +1,使用OS的VM,有RAM-FS的速度,又兼HDD的大容量。
    rhwood
        3
    rhwood  
       2012-05-14 09:59:02 +08:00   3
    Varnish 提供了包括ESI等在内的非常多的缓存特性,缓存建立在内存绕开硬盘IO,效率高稳定性强这些都比squid优势大的多,但它不是一个专业的反向代理;Haprox是一个专业的反向代理和负载均衡工具,为企业用户提供了一个高价硬件以外的解决方案。Varnish和Haproxy都成功应用过10gbps的网络环境中。
    gonbo
        4
    gonbo  
       2012-05-14 09:59:08 +08:00   1
    @livid 自己想做cdn呀? squid有些不错的功能,比如refresh_stale_hit,所以一般前端是nginx, 后端是squid。
    likuku
        5
    likuku  
       2012-05-14 10:05:26 +08:00
    我所在公司的网站,曾经用过16台Squid+4GB纯RAM/tmpfs(不用硬盘)作图片缓存,后来使用3台相同机器跑Varnish就够了。
    muxi
        6
    muxi  
       2012-05-14 10:06:49 +08:00   4
    squid 不是不能取代,而是有很多人熟悉这个,就跟阿里系一直在用apache一样,虽然最近一年有所改善。

    很多公司使用开源产品,特别是大公司,不仅仅是产品本身,自己也做了很多满足本公司需求的模块,比如阿里系Apache上就做了比如黑名单,比如日志处理,比如统计,比如在每个页面输出的时候自动追加某些跟踪信息,比如对流量控制,甚至缓存调度等等,太多太多,如果换成Nginx这些模块都得重新开发一遍,而不一定能找到对应的人能开发这些,在Nginx上模块逐渐能够开发的时候,现在慢慢的开始移植过来

    Squid 曾经在CDN和缓存领域有无可争辩的地位,积累了大批的技术人才,也积累无数的实践模式和实践经验,从知识储备上还具有领先优势,Varnish之类的后起之秀要超越它,至少要在知识和社区储备上,再更上几层楼
    laneovcc
        7
    laneovcc  
       2012-05-14 11:17:22 +08:00   1
    nginx
    优点: 简单粗暴有效, 直接使用操作系统的文件系统和磁盘缓存机制,配置简单, 可以把静态缓存和动态代理合并, 响应时间快, 各种限制acl都能实现. 配合@agentzh的lua模块可以非常灵活

    缺点:统计不足.

    squid
    优点: 各种你想看不想看的统计数据都有, 自带sibling模式, 支持Tproxy.

    缺点:傻大笨粗, 响应时间巨慢, 配置文件不清晰.
    ipoh
        8
    ipoh  
       2012-05-14 11:43:07 +08:00   1
    没有什么是不可取代的,但是所用的技术不是唯一的考量。
    关于     帮助文档     自助推广系统     博客     API     FAQ &nbs;   Solana     1007 人在线   最高记录 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 26ms UTC 18:51 PVG 02:51 LAX 10:51 JFK 13:51
    Do have faith in what you're doing.
    ubao msn sn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86